que utilice las siguientes líneas a información progreso de salida de mi simulación en mi programa C++,eliminación de parpadeo del cursor en la terminal, ¿cómo?
double N=0;
double percent=0;
double total = 1000000;
for (int i; i<total; ++i)
{
percent = 100*i/total;
printf("\r[%6.4f%%]",percent);
}
Trabaja muy bien!
Pero el problema es que veo que el cursor del terminal sigue parpadeando cíclicamente a través de los números, esto es muy molesto, ¿alguien sabe cómo deshacerse de esto?
He visto algunos programas como wget o ubuntu apt, usan la barra de progreso o porcentajes también, pero parece que no hay problema con el cursor parpadeante, me pregunto cómo lo hicieron?
Gracias!
Desafortunadamente, no tiene éxito :( – Daniel
¿Por qué necesita porcentajes? Simplemente puede escribir caracteres '#', uno tras otro. Por ejemplo, un '#' por cada 10% nuevo – kol
OOPS, me encantan los números :) Bien, Intentaré # y le dejaré saber los resultados, pero de todos modos, solo un google, alguien dijo que wget no usó ncurses – Daniel